Cervical CT Angiography: The Advantage of Ultra-High-Resolution CT Versus Conventional HRCT

Abstract

Pre-treatment depiction of the cervical arteries is important for better intra-arterial infusion therapy of malignant head and neck tumors. There have not been any studies on the image quality of ultra-high-resolution computed tomography (U-HRCT) for cervical CT angiography (CTA). The aim of this study is to evaluate the advantages of U-HRCT over conventional HRCT for cervical CTA; Methods: Forty-one patients underwent cervical CTA prior to selective intra-arterial infusion chemotherapy for malignant head and neck tumors. Twenty-two patients were scanned on conventional HRCT, while the remaining nineteen on U-HRCT. U-HRCT super-high-resolution (SHR) mode was used in 8 patients, while high-resolution (HR) mode was used in 11 patients. On CTA, the visibility of 18 branches from bilateral external carotid arteries was evaluated using a 5-point scale by three radiologists in consensus. Prior to the patient study, a head-neck CT phantom study regarding mock arterial density and its visibility was performed; Results: Regarding the patient study, the mean score of the SHR mode for visibility was significantly higher than that of conventional HRCT in 17 of 18 arteries (p < 0.05). The mean score of the HR mode for visibility was significantly higher than that of conventional HRCT in all arteries (p < 0.05). Regarding the phantom study, the maximum density of the SHR mode was significantly higher than that of conventional HRCT for mock proximal and peripheral arteries (p < 0.01). In addition, the visual score of the SHR mode for mock arteries was significantly higher than that of conventional HRCT (p < 0.05); Conclusions: U-HRCT provides higher image quality in terms of visualization of the arteries than conventional HRCT in cervical CTA.
